What is a Pallet?
A pallet is a flat structure, normally made of wood, plastic, or metal, that provides a stable base for stacking, saving, and carrying goods. Pallets permit for much easier handling with forklifts and pallet jacks, enhancing the space and effectiveness in warehouses and storage centers.

Pallets help with vertical storage, permitting storage facilities to maximize vertical space. Rather of stacking products haphazardly, using pallets provides a methodical technique to warehousing. This vertical structure can frequently release up floor area, making it possible for more efficient workflows.
Effective Handling
By standardizing storage on pallets, employees can use forklifts and pallet jacks to move big amounts of products quickly. This lowers manual labor, increasing labor efficiency, and potentially decreasing the threat of work environment injuries.
Inventory Management
Pallets are essential for stock control. Making use of pallets enables clearer visibility of stock levels, which assists in tracking supplies and handling stock levels better. In addition, each pallet can be tagged with barcodes or RFID tags, enhancing the precision of inventory management systems.

Environmental Impact
Sustainability is significantly becoming a crucial focus for warehouse operations. Utilizing recyclable pallets or those made from sustainable materials can reduce environmental effect. Picking plastic or composite pallets can likewise cause decreased waste gradually.

A: The ideal pallet depends upon numerous elements, including the type of goods being stored, weight capacity, dealing with techniques, and budget. Make sure that you examine your special requirements before choosing.
Q2: How often should palleted items be checked?
A: Palleted items need to be inspected frequently-- preferably, before usage and every couple of months throughout storage-- to identify any damage or hazards.
Q3: Can pallets be reused?

Q4: Are there specific policies for pallet use in certain markets?
A: Yes, particular industries such as food and pharmaceuticals have rigorous guidelines concerning pallet usage to guarantee hygiene and safety. It's critical to research and comprehend these guidelines.
Q5: How do I determine the lifespan of a pallet?
A: The life-span of a pallet is influenced by its material, use, and handling. Routine inspections can help you examine the condition and identify whether a pallet is safe for continued use.
